"Penelope" by W. Somerset Maugham is a comedic play revolving around Penelope, a middle-aged woman who financially supports her artistic husband. When her husband's old flame returns, Penelope fears the rekindled romance. Misunderstandings and humorous situations arise as characters grapple with love, loyalty, and societal expectations.
